The second-tallest waterfall in the Niagara Region

Situated in the Twenty Valley, Balls Falls Conservation Area is a beautiful place to visit year-round. With spectacular scenery, this area has been preserved to showcase the natural beauty of the Niagara escarpment.

Famous for a host of waterfalls and trails, this is a popular spot to bring the family for a hike or a swim on a warm day. A historic village is located within the conservation area, and visitors can take heritage tours of the village.
